Output 778c164de30a13a8f2471338112f80b2bf84aab57a018efba86a94f77b3886aa:0

value
43403000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d88fb79e99f0b715351ea9d021620bb1edda3a OP_EQUAL
address
M8S53LcJ3DgFXWWu377ifUBTbKJH2WjpDk
transaction
778c164de30a13a8f2471338112f80b2bf84aab57a018efba86a94f77b3886aa
spent
true